We investigate the approximation of fractional resolvents, extending and improving some corresponding results on semigroups and resolvents. As applications, we utilize the approach of Meyer approximation to analyze the time optimal control problem of a Riemann-Liouville fractional system without Lipschitz continuity. A fractional diffusion model is also presented to confirm our theoretical findings.
